TASK 75-24-48-300-014 HPT ACC Air Tubes - Replace the Pin, Repair-014 (VRS1549)
Effectivity
FIG/ITEM | PART NO. |
02-200 | 2A1545 |
02-210 | 2A1549 |
02-220 | 2A1553 |
02-230 | 2A1557 |
02-400 | 2A1547 |
02-410 | 2A1551 |
02-420 | 2A1555 |
02-430 | 2A1559 |
Material of component
PART IDENT | SYMBOL | MATERIAL |
TCC tube assembly | Fe 18.5 Cr-11 Ni-0.4 Ti | |
TCC tube assembly (Pin) | Fe 18.5 Cr-11 Ni-0.4 Ti |

Refer to Figure.
Use a Grinder, hand held pneumatic.
Refer to Figure.
Cut out the pin.
SUBTASK 75-24-48-350-146 Cut Out the Pin
Refer to Cleaning-000 TASK 75-24-48-100-100.
Remove all the oxides, hydrocarbon, grit and scale from the surface to be welded and adjacent area by local cleaning.
SUBTASK 75-24-48-350-147 Remove all the Soil from the Surface
Refer to Figure.
Refer to Figure.
Refer to SPM TASK 70-31-02-310-501-001.
Weld the pin to the support by tungsten inert gas (TIG) weld.
Use a Grinder, hand held pneumatic.
In contact area, remove excess weld and dress flush with adjacent area.
SUBTASK 75-24-48-350-148 Weld the Pin
Stress relieve at 1200 deg F plus or minus 25 deg F (649 deg C plus or minus 14 deg C) for one hour.
Heat treat the TCC tube assemblies.
SUBTASK 75-24-48-310-079 Heat Treat the TCC Tube Assemblies
Refer to SPM TASK 70-23-05-230-501.
Penetrant examine the repaired area.
Use a 8x Magnifying Glass.
Refer to Inspection-000 TASK 75-24-48-200-100.
Visually examine the repaired area.
SUBTASK 75-24-48-220-090 Examine the Welded Area for Cracks
